No. A genuine scholarship never charges an application fee. Every listing here links to the provider's own official page — apply there, and treat any site asking for payment to "process" a scholarship as fraudulent.
Often yes, but it depends on each scheme's terms. Government schemes usually bar you from holding a second government award at the same time, while private and institutional awards are frequently allowed alongside them. Check the eligibility section of each scholarship before applying to both.
